Transaction 3ff316dcab98b85c91d6cfee1807c2a377e6b01a90842a54c5ee58d14e04d718

1 Input
2 Outputs
  • 3ff316dcab98b85c91d6cfee1807c2a377e6b01a90842a54c5ee58d14e04d718:0
  • value  3526000
    address  16yCFJE1ot33cXxHYmv6AcrJyKujwFMn5t
  • 3ff316dcab98b85c91d6cfee1807c2a377e6b01a90842a54c5ee58d14e04d718:1
  • value  75795129
    address  16r1uSznMvPUipDH882PJezcsxNAc3JdAF